Experience: Experienced The Senior Systems Engineer is responsible for systems management across Linux, Unix and Windows server environments in collaboration with networking, database, application development, and internet development teams. Key responsibilities include system installation, operating system patch management, system integration, application administration, systems architecture and design support, and ongoing system maintenance. This role operates in a diverse environment that includes leading-edge technologies, multiple cloud platforms, Oracle engineered systems, Oracle servers running Solaris 10 and 11, and x86 servers running Oracle Linux and other Linux/Unix versions. The storage infrastructure includes network-attached storage (NAS) usually based on Oracle ZFS appliances. Job Type: Full-Time Employee Location: 100% Remote Job Requirements
